WorkSafeBC has fined North Central Roofing Ltd. $7,500 after two employees were found working on a Prince George duplex without proper fall protection in place and one of them was using a nail gun while not wearing safety glasses.
The fine was imposed in January, according to a posting on the WorkSafeBC website, and was the third fine levied against the company in six months. The two previous fines, of $7,500 and $2,500 were for violations at two Quesnel worksites.
North Central is appealing the most-recent penalty.
